Erin Lynch is a music industry lifer. She has never performed in front of thousands or topped the Billboard charts, but she is an integral part of the global entertainment business whose existence makes it possible for artists to achieve their dreams. Erin appears on High Notes to offer a look at the reality of life behind-the-scenes. She tells us about the temptations of alcohol on tour and how a year spent in lockdown helped her achieve and maintain sobriety.
